Let’s look into the disability insurance policy a bit more in-depth: Two different plans, Short and long term. Short term will provide any income replacement protection; this can be received from one week of disability up to a 6month term. Long term is a type of disability protection which starts from that 6month mark and beyond. This is noteworthy even though it’s not part of a homeowners’ policy. You’d have to get flood insurance at up to $400 every year if you have a house in a flood-prone region. Bear in mind that your mortgagor will make it compulsory that you get flood insurance if you go for a home in a flood area. You will save yourself such unnecessary expense by buying a house in a region that isn’t suffering such.

To ensure you save on your home insurance, getting a CLUE before purchasing a house is not optional. C.L.U.E comprehensive Loss underwriting exchange is a report that shows you things that would cost you in the house you want to purchase.

Lets get more clues. A house in a town with only a volunteer fire service attracts a higher home insurance rates. Also, the further away your house is from a fire hydrant, the higher your rate would be. In the same vein, the further your house is from the nearest police station, the higher your home insurance rates would be. The reverse also holds true.

Therefore, ensure you don’t pay for a home unless you’ve checked this report. The little savings you made on a home purchase might pale in significance to the premiums you’ll pay over the years.

Many people’s homes are their getaway from everyday life as well as a huge monetary investment. It is important to protect this investment as well as the property that is contained inside. Finding insurance for a home is easy when searching for home insurance quotes on the internet.

Different types of homes require different insurance policies based on the structural type of home. Coverage for a single family home will generally include the entire structure and its contents. It will also usually include out buildings like sheds and detached garages. There are numerous subcategories within single family home insurance such as total replacement value versus assessed value, as well as riders to cover the full replacement of valuable items like jewelry, clothing and furs.

Coverage for a condominium is different. It will usually cover the inside walls and items like light fixtures. It will not however cover the outside walls. It is usually assumed that damages to external walls are the responsibility of a homeowner’s association or similar entity. Condo owners should familiarize themselves with the specific laws in the state where the condo is located.

Manufactured homes and communities are very popular today, especially with the 50 plus community. Here again, seeking out specific home insurance quotes for this type of home is important. Most of these policies will cover the exterior and interior as well as the contents of a manufactured home but usually will not cover any detached buildings.

Anyone who does not own the home that they live in needs to have their own type of insurance coverage to protect their belongings. This can be done through getting home insurance quotes for those who rent. Insurance for rentals is only going to cover the items that are owned by the policy holder.

Home insurance quotes should specifically state what types of disaster and weather related events are covered. Typically damage from smoke, fire, wind and lighting are covered. Other less common disasters like explosions, damage from the weight of snow or ice can also be covered. Vandalism and theft are keys areas to review for coverage levels.

In most policies, there are damages that are specifically not going to be paid off. These can be purchased as an addendum to the original policy if the purchaser wants it included. This is going to raise the costs of the premiums so that should be kept in mind. The status of the home when purchased is also going to determine what type of coverage that is offered.

The last consideration after deciding the amount and type of insurance is the actual cost that the consumer is going to pay. There are deductibles to be considered as well as how much the payments are going to be. The amount that the insurance is going to cover is also going to play a part. A home that is worth a million dollars should not have coverage of a hundred thousand dollars. Make sure that all home insurance quotes are gone over with a fine tooth comb so that nothing is missed.

Steps To Follow If Your Involved In A Car Crash

Sunday, January 3rd, 2010

Many times when a person is involved in an accident emotions can run very high and it’s easy to forget to follow the proper procedures. If you drive car on a regular basis the odds are pretty good that at some point you’ll be involved in an accident. When the time comes, following a few simple steps can help to keep the accident scene as safe as possible, and will help to ensure that the at fault party assumes responsibility. Take a few minutes to write down the following steps and keep the information in your glove compartment.

* The first thing to do if you’re involved in an accident is to stop your vehicle and pull off the road if possible.

* If anyone is hurt call 911.

* Beware of anyone who doesn’t want the police involved. Call the police and report the accident. Call the police!

* If the vehicles can’t be driven put out flares or cones to redirect traffic around the accident.

* Exchange information including , name, address, and phone numbers of all drivers and witnesses. Driver’s license numbers and license plate numbers. Insurance company info. Year, make and model of vehicles involved once the accident scene is safe.

* Make some notes about the accident including exact time and location, weather and road conditions.

* Ask witnesses to write a short statement of what they saw.

* Only discuss the accident with the police. Don’t give your opinion of what happened without the police present.

* When the police arrive give them your full cooperation. Get the officer’s badge number and ask for a copy of the accident report.

* Call your insurance company and report the accident as soon as possible.

Being involved in an accident can be a frightening experience. Knowing what to do beforehand can help make a bad situation a little easier to deal with. Reviewing your auto insurance policy to make sure you have the right coverage is always a good idea.
